一、flask运行在debug模式的时候,celery无法收到flask中发送给celery的异步任务 run.py task.py ...
分类:
其他好文 时间:
2018-11-30 16:39:09
阅读次数:
189
什么是restful? REST与技术无关,代表的是一种软件架构风格,REST是Representational State Transfer的简称,中文翻译为“表征状态转移”或“表现层状态转化”。 API与用户的通信协议 总是使用HTTPs协议。 域名 https://api.example.co ...
一、Celery介绍 Celery 是一个 基于python开发的分布式异步消息任务队列,通过它可以轻松的实现任务的异步处理, 如果你的业务场景中需要用到异步任务,就可以考虑使用celery, 举几个实例场景中可用的例子: Celery 在执行任务时需要通过一个消息中间件来接收和发送任务消息,以及存 ...
分类:
其他好文 时间:
2018-11-22 00:15:23
阅读次数:
439
本章的主题是Bitmap的加载和Cache,主要包含三个方面的内容。首先讲述如何有效地加载一个Bitmap,这是一个很有意义的话题,由于Bitmap的特殊性以及Android对单个应用所施加的内存限制,比如16MB,这导致Bitmap加载的时候很容易出现内存溢出。下面这个异常信息在开发中应该经常遇到 ...
分类:
移动开发 时间:
2018-11-22 00:12:29
阅读次数:
206
python—Celery异步分布式 Celery 是一个python开发的异步分布式任务调度模块,是一个消息传输的中间件,可以理解为一个邮箱,每当应用程序调用celery的异步任务时,会向broker传递消息,然后celery的worker从中取消息 Celery 用于存储消息以及celery执行 ...
分类:
编程语言 时间:
2018-11-20 15:02:59
阅读次数:
250
想用django做一个自动运维平台,利用netsnmp来获取交换机及服务器信息,但是snmpget任务需要在后台实时运行,为了不影响html响应,利用celery来结合django做异步任务队列。一、环境准备1.首先安装celerypip3installcelery2.安装djcelerypip3installdjango-celery3.安装一个broker我们必须拥有一个broker消息队列用
分类:
其他好文 时间:
2018-11-11 23:38:29
阅读次数:
309
settimeout疑惑总结 1.settimeout是异步任务,要等主线程的事情做完了才能执行,多个settimeout在一个队列里先进先出。因此,严谨的说,不是时间到了执行,时间到了后会被放在队列里,等主线程空闲了才来执行它。 DOM 学DOM就是学习document对象id不能改??id是只读 ...
分类:
编程语言 时间:
2018-11-11 15:59:58
阅读次数:
133
1. 理解同步与异步的概念(看第一个图) 2. 宏任务与微任务,简单说主线程上的最外层代码块就是宏任务(包括Promise和setTimeout), 如果最外层代码块是异步任务,那么它内部的任务就是微任务 3. 宏任务与微任务相当于主线程和子线程的关系,但是可以理解为js中只有一个主线程和一个子线程 ...
分类:
其他好文 时间:
2018-11-03 12:38:06
阅读次数:
155
参考: celery官方文档 Django中使用celery完成异步任务 Django中使用celery耗时任务 ...
分类:
其他好文 时间:
2018-10-30 13:07:26
阅读次数:
145
Spring通过任务执行器(TaskExecutor)来实现多线程和并发编程。使用ThreadPoolTaskExecutor可实现一个基于线程池的TaskExecutor。而实际开发中任务一般是非阻碍的,即异步的,所以我们要在配置类中通过@EnableAsync 开启对异步任务的支持,并通过实际执 ...
分类:
编程语言 时间:
2018-10-29 16:01:11
阅读次数:
174